From a33a1eb90413e9ae6de57a5f1d4b6ac6e043b337 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Nathan Sobo Date: Tue, 14 Apr 2026 11:26:44 -0600 Subject: [PATCH] agent_ui: Reuse visible sessions when reopening threads (#53905) When reopening a thread that is already visible in the agent panel, `open_thread` could recreate the session instead of reusing the existing visible thread. That left the UI holding a thread whose backend session could be closed out from under it.
